    ‘Fast and Farmer-ish’ host joins Kramp for LAMMA debut

    Tom Pemberton, Kramp ambassador, has a dedicated YouTube channel documenting his Lancashire farming life

    LAMMA 2022 will see Kramp make its show debut alongside brand ambassador and ‘Fast and Farmer-ish’ host and influencer Tom Pemberton. Visitors to Kramp’s LAMMA stand (19.230) will also have the chance to win a £3,000 workshop makeover, or a £1,000 webshop spending spree.

    To celebrate the launch of Kramp’s ‘Workshop Solutions’ service, one Kramp-stand visitor will win a complete workshop revamp, up to the value of £3,000.

    Neil Adams, Kramp’s business solutions consultant said: “We know we can’t buy time, but we can save time. We’ve launched our workshop planning service to help you and your team – whether you’re a farmer, contractor, or engineer – create the perfect workshop shelving solution: saving time, money and effort.”

    Visitors can also win £1,000 to spend on the Kramp webshop, which stocks more than 500,000 product lines from 3,000 brands. On the webshop, users can place an order from anywhere, at anytime, with the choice of either next day direct-to-farm delivery or collection from a trusted local dealer.

    Kramp’s team of product specialists will be on the LAMMA stand (19.230) throughout the two days of the show, taking technical questions and demonstrating the new features of the Kramp app, such as the Product Configurator and the AI-powered Product Recognition tool.
